WORLDWIDE PANIC to release Alanis Morissette cover

It is not everyday that you would come across bands even mentioning the name Alanis Morissette, leave along covering one of her songs. Los Angeles based hard rock / heavy metal group WORLDWIDE PANIC are releasing a cover of the Canadian singer-songwriters ’90s hit “You Oughta Know”, February 8 2019 on all digital platforms.

Worldwide Panic frontman Lane Steele recalls how this outlandish idea came about: “We were in the middle of recording a bunch of songs in the studio for about a month or so. Long days, so I like to take baths. Baths where for some reason I watch cheesy reality shows such as Real Housewives, etc. I was in the bath watching this awful show that I have no clue as to why I like, and I started humming the intro melody to this song. I was like, ‘Huh, what song is that’? At that point I realized it was Alanis Morissette’s “You Oughta Know”. I found the karaoke version and started to sing it in my style and thought is sounded pretty interesting. So I called the studio like I own it and said, ‘I need to get in there tomorrow!’ They wondered why, because our tracks were already done. I told them my idea and they replied, ‘That’s amazing, we will see you at 10 AM!’ I stayed up, wrote the demo, went in, and the rest is history, as they say. So, enjoy our twisted, dark and heavy rendition of a ’90s classic which is Worldwide Panic’s, ‘You Oughta Know’!

Worldwide Panic will trek across the U.S. for five straight weeks this February-March as support act to alt-metal giants Mushroomhead and traveling rock ‘n roll circus sideshow Hellzapoppin, along with Cleveland, Ohio industrial metal band Ventana. For Worldwide Panic, this tour is well poised to build on the success of their Fall 2018 tour supporting Flaw and Smile Empty Soul

The band says about the tour: “This is a dream tour for all of us in Worldwide Panic. All our fans are excited to see us and Mushroomhead pair up together!”
